Chris Eubank Jr vs Martin Murray preview

When is Eubank Jr vs Murray?

Chris Eubank Jr could face the challenge of Martin Murray in Autumn/Fall 2023 at The O2 Arena in London.

The fight would take place over 12 rounds in the Middleweight division, which means the weight limit would be 160 pounds (11.4 stone or 72.6 KG).

Eubank Jr vs Murray stats

Chris Eubank Jr would step into the ring with a record of 32 wins, 3 loses and 0 draws, 23 of those wins coming by the way of knock out.

Martin Murray would make his way to the ring with a record of 39 wins, 6 loses and 1 draw, with 17 of those wins by knock out.

The stats suggest Eubank Jr would have a large advantage in power over Murray, boosting at 72% knock out percentage over Murray's 44%.

Chris Eubank Jr is the younger man by 7 years, at 33 years old.

Murray has a height advantage of 1 inch over Eubank Jr. This also extends to a 1-inch reach advantage.

Both Chris Eubank Jr & Martin Murray fight out of an orthodox stance.

Eubank Jr is currently the less experienced professional fighter, having had 11 less fights, and made his debut in 2011, 4 year and 1 month later than Murray, whose first professional fight was in 2007. He has fought 91 less professional rounds, 217 to Murray's 308.

Chris Eubank Jr goes into the fight ranked number 8 by the WBC and 9 by the RING at middleweight.

Eubank Jr vs Murray form

Eubank Jr has beaten 4 of his last 5 opponents, stopping 2 of them, going the distance twice.

In his last fight, he lost to Liam Smith on 21st January 2023 by technical knockout in the 4th round at Manchester Arena, Manchester, United Kingdom.

Previous to that, he had won against Liam Williams on 5th February 2022 by unanimous decision in their 12 round contest at Motorpoint Arena, Wales.

Going into that contest, he had beat Wanik Awdijan on 16th October 2021 by technical knockout in the 5th round at Newcastle Arena, Tyne and Wear.

Before that, he had defeated Marcus Morrison on 1st May 2021 by unanimous decision in their 10 round contest at Manchester Arena, Manchester.

He had won against Matt Korobov on 7th December 2019 by technical knockout in the 2nd round in their WBA Interim World Middleweight and WBA World Middleweight championship fight at Barclays Center, New York, United States.

Martin Murray has beaten 3 of his last 5 opponents.

In his last fight, he lost to Billy Joe Saunders on 4th December 2020 by unanimous decision in their WBO World Super Middleweight championship fight at Wembley (SSE) Arena, London, United Kingdom.

Previous to that, he had defeated Sladan Janjanin on 15th November 2019 by points in the 8th round at Olympia, Merseyside.

Going into that contest, he had beat Rui Manuel Pavanito on 12th July 2019 by points in the 10th round at Olympia, Merseyside.

Before that, he had been beaten by Hassan N’Dam on 22nd December 2018 by majority decision in their 12 round contest at Manchester Arena, Manchester.

He had won against Roberto Garcia on 23rd June 2018 by unanimous decision in their 12 round contest at The O2 Arena, London.

Activity check

In terms of recent activity, Chris Eubank Jr has been fighting more than Martin Murray.

Chris Eubank Jr last fought 2 months and 7 days ago, while Martin Murray's last outing was 2 years, 3 months and 24 days ago.

Eubank Jr's last 5 fights have come over a period of 3 years, 3 months and 21 days, meaning he has been fighting on average every 7 months and 29 days. In those fights, he fought a total of 33 rounds, meaning that they have lasted 6.6 rounds on average.

Murray's last 5 fights have come over a period of 4 years, 9 months and 5 days, meaning he has been fighting on average every 11 months and 13 days. In those fights, he fought a total of 54 rounds, meaning that they have lasted 10.8 rounds on average.
